Russian servicemen manning positions in the Lugansk People’s Republic have repelled 23 Ukrainian attacks over the past week, said LPR Acting Head Leonid Pasechnik.  
“Our servicemen have again shown their combat superiority over Ukrainian armed formations equipped with western weapons,” Pasechnik wrote on Telegram. “Over the past week, our fighters repelled 23 enemy attacks on their positions.”
  He noted the efficient work of artillerymen and drone operators who left the advancing Ukrainian groups without fire support.  
The enemy losses amounted to 185 in dead or wounded in the failed attempts to break through in the areas of Berestovoye-Pereyezdnoye, Novodruzhevsk-Grigorovka, Volcheyarovka-Ivano-Daryevka and Artyomovsk-Kleshcheyevka, the LPR leader said.
  Russian servicemen eliminated: - 24 guns and mortars including one Polish-made “krab” self-propelled howitzer and one US-made M777 artillery piece; more than 10 recoilless guns, anti-tank missile systems, heavy machine guns and grenade launchers; - six armored vehicles including two Bradleys and one tank; - ten cars including HMMWV vehicles; - eight field ammunition depots; - three temporary duty stations.   “Air defense and electronic warfare systems foiled all the 44 attempts to violate our Republic’s air space. The enemy lost more than 60 unmanned aerial vehicles;  I’m confident that our guys will cope with any combat mission,” Pasechnik said.   ***   The Ukrainian government launched the so-called anti-terrorist operation against Donbass in April 2014.  The peace talks failed to reach tangible results due to Kiev’s position to settle the conflict by force.   President Vladimir Putin announced a special military operation on February 24, 2022 to protect Donbass residents from Ukrainian aggression.
